Italy’s Luca Dotto clinched the men’s 100-meter free title at the 2016 European Championships.
Dotto, who is second in the world with a 47.96 from Italian Nationals, turned in a 48.25 for the win tonight.
The Netherlands’ Sebastiaan Verschuren pushed the pace with a second-place time of 48.32. Meanwhile, France’s Clement Mignon snared third overall in 48.36.
France’s Jeremy Stravius (48.53), Belgium’s Pieter Timmers (48.64), Serbia’s Velimir Stjepanovic (48.72), Belgium’s Glenn Surgeloose (48.75) and Russia’s Andrey Grechin (48.85) also swam for the title.
